What the Data Says About Shandiin
The Social Security Administration has registered 162 babies named Shandiin between 1989 and 2022, spanning 34 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a girl's name, Shandiin currently falls outside the top 1,000 girls' names for 2022. The name reached its historical peak in 2003, when 12 babies received it in a single year.
Decade-level aggregation shows that Shandiin performed strongest in the 2000s, accumulating 80 births during that ten-year window. These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 162 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
